Abstract
Provided herein are systems and methods for the detection, quantification, and/or monitoring of analytes in samples. The systems and methods can be used, for example, to track the deposition and electrochemical behavior of individual nanoparticles and nanoparticles clusters clusters in situ with high spatial and temporal resolution. The systems and methods can be used to track the deposition and oxidation of several hundreds to thousands of nanoparticles simultaneously and reconstruct their voltammetric curves at the single nanoparticle level.
